Bootstrap mendefinisikan gaya yang sederhana dan mudah digunakan bagi kami. Kami hanya membutuhkan spesifikasi gaya yang sangat sedikit untuk melengkapi tampilan halaman yang sederhana dan elegan.
Artikel ini terutama memperkenalkan kontrol dasar berikut:
1. Tabel
2. Formulir
3. Tombol
1. Tabel masih digunakan untuk mewakili tabel menggunakan <ableby> <Thead> <tBody> <ttr> <t th> <td>. Ada kelas -kelas berikut untuk mengontrol sifat -sifat tabel. Gaya tabel akan mengisi wadah induk secara default.
<div> <div> <div> <able> <tr> <th> Judul 1 </t> <th> Judul 2 </t th> <th> Judul 3 </t th> </tr> <tr> <td> 1 </td> <td> </tr> </td> </TR> </TR> </TR> </TR> </TR> </TR> </TR> </TR> </TR> </TD> </TD> </TD> </TD> </TD> </TD> </tr> </able> </div> </div> </div> </div> </boable> </div> </div> </div> </boable> </div> </div> </tv> </tr> </table> </div> </div> </tv> </tr> </table> </div> </div> </div> </tv> </tr> </table> </div> </div> </Div> </tv> </tr> </dif> </div> </Div> </Div> </tr> </Table> </div> </Div> </Div> </tr> </Table> </div> </Div>
Bungkus. Tabel dalam. Tabel-responsif membuat tabel responsif yang menggulir secara horizontal pada perangkat layar kecil (kurang dari 768px). Ketika layar lebih besar dari lebar 768px, bilah gulir horizontal menghilang.
2. Bentuk bentuk, sebagaimana didefinisikan dalam beberapa gaya
LAC dan kontrol harus dibungkus dengan Div Form-Group. Formulir default adalah sebagai berikut
<div> <norm> <div> <label for = "exampedInputeMail1"> Alamat email </label> <input type = "email" id = "exampleInputeMail1" placeholder = "masukkan email"> </div> <ver> <label untuk = "Contohinpaspassword1"> Kata sandi </label> <input type = "kata sandi" id = "Contoh <input type = "checkbox"> periksa saya </label> </div> <typute type = "kirim"> kirim </aton> </form> </div>
Formulir inline, tentukan kategori khusus SR untuk label, dan dapat menyembunyikan label, tetapi lable tidak boleh dihilangkan.
<div> <norm> <div> <label for = "exampedInputeMail1"> Alamat email </label> <input type = "email" id = "exampleInputeMail1" placeholder = "masukkan email"> </div> <ver> <label untuk = "Contohinpaspassword1"> Kata sandi </label> <input type = "kata sandi" id = "Contoh <input type = "checkbox"> periksa saya </label> </div> <typute type = "kirim"> kirim </aton> </form> </div>
Bentuk tipe horizontal , Anda harus menentukan panjang untuk grup latable dan tag, dan menggunakan tata letak sistem grid. Label disejajarkan kanan, grup label disejajarkan ke kiri.
<div> <norm> <div> <label for = "exampedInputeMail1"> Alamat email </label> <ver> <input type = "email" id = "exampedInputeMail1" placeholder = "masukkan email"> </div> </div> <Div> <label for = "exampleInputPassword1"> Kata sandi </div> </div> <Div> <label untuk = "exampleInputPassword1"> Kata sandi </label> </Div> <Inputer "Tipe =" Contoh "IDPASPASSWORD1"> Kata Sandi </Label> </Div> <inputer "Tipe =" Contoh "IDPASSWORD1"> Kata Sandi </Label> </Div> <inputer " </div> </div> <div> <label> <input type = "checkbox"> periksa saya </label> </div> <tombol type = "kirim"> Kirim </button> </form> </div>
Verifikasi bentuk bentuk, bootstrap3 mendukung verifikasi formulir khusus. Menambahkan req uired berarti bahwa formulir diperlukan, node.setCustomValidity dapat mengatur verifikasi kustom formulir
<div> <norm> <div> <label for = "exampleInputeMail1"> Alamat email </label> <ver> <input type = "email" id = "exampedInputeMail1" placeholder = "masukkan email" diperlukan> </div> </div> <Div> <label untuk = "kata sandi" "> label </label> <Div> </Div> <Div> <label untuk =" kata sandi ""> label </label> <Div> <Div> <Div> <label for = "kata sandi" "kata sandi </label> <Div> <Input> Kata Sandi =" Kata Sandi " onchange="checkPassword()"> </div> </div><div> <label for="password2" onchange="checkPassword()"> Password2</label> <div> <input type="password" id="password2" placeholder="Password2" required> </div> </div> <div> <label> <input type="checkbox"> Check me out </label> </div> <button type = "Kirim"> Kirim </button> </form> </div> <script> Function CheckPassWord () {var pwd1 = $ ("#password1"). Val (); var pwd2 = $ ("#password2"). val (); if (pwd1! = pwd2) {document.geteLementById ("password1"). setCustomValidity ("Kata sandi yang dimasukkan dua kali tidak konsisten"); } else {document.getElementById ("password1"). setCustomValidity (""); }} </script>3. Gaya tombol
Gunakan .btn-lg, .btn-sm, dan .btn-xs untuk mendapatkan tombol dengan ukuran yang berbeda. Menambahkan .btn-blok ke tombol dapat membuatnya mengisi 100% lebar simpul induk, dan tombol juga menjadi elemen tingkat blok, dan menambahkan kelas tombol ke elemen <a>, <aTy> atau <spitput>.
<Div> <tombol type = "Tombol"> default </attones> <tombol type = "Tombol"> primer </button> <tombol type = "Tombol"> Sukses </button> <Tombol Type = "Tombol"> Info </button> <Tombol Type = "Tombol"> </buttone> <tombol type = "Tombol"> Tombol </tombol </buttpon </Tombol </Tombol Tombol "> Tombol </"> Tombol </">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Tombol </Button type = "Kirim"> Tombol </button> <input type = "tombol" value = "input"> <input type = "kirim" value = "kirim"> </div>
Jika Anda masih ingin belajar secara mendalam, Anda dapat mengklik di sini untuk mempelajari dan melampirkan dua topik menarik kepada Anda: Tutorial Pembelajaran Bootstrap Bootstrap Tutorial Praktis
Di atas adalah semua tentang artikel ini, saya harap ini akan membantu untuk pembelajaran semua orang.